What's Happening?
During a recent NBA game between the Minnesota Timberwolves and the Denver Nuggets, a technical outage at the Target Center led to a disruption in the collection and dissemination of game statistics. The
outage affected the ability to track player performance and game progress, which is typically monitored through advanced digital systems. This incident highlights the reliance on technology in modern sports for real-time data analysis and fan engagement. The Timberwolves and Nuggets, both competitive teams in the league, were unable to provide detailed statistical updates to fans and analysts during the game, impacting the overall experience and post-game analysis.
